- >I have a A1200 and I can't get it to work with new Seagate ST51080A.
- >When I start RDPrep it says: "Can't find scsi.device" ??? Why scsi.device
- >when it is a IDE drive?

- I recently got the same drive. I installed it with HDToolbox (standard
- version).
-
- 1. First select "Change drive type"
- 2. Choose "Define New" (It is SCSI type)
- 3. Then choose "Read Configuration"
- 4. Switch off "Support Reselection"
- 5. Then choose "Ok"
- 6. "Ok" again
- 7. Everything will be saved now
- 8. Then partition the drive (I presume you know how this works)
- 9. At last : "Save Changes To Drive"
-
- Reset and your drive will be recognised by the computer.
- Then format the drive from WorkBench.

- Info about the drive :
-
- - It's very quiet
- - When I move the mouse over the menu (right mouse button pressed) I hear the
- drive make a different sound (?). The sound changes. If I scroll through text
- (with the mouse) I hear the same. With every click the sound changes.
- - It's not very fast (only 1.5 Mbytes/second) :-(
- - It starts without problems (No need to reset when you switch on the computer)
- - Formatted size 1033 Mbyte
- - It fits without problems (No need to cut metal)
- - It vibrates (I have put some foam between the drive and shielding of
- the computer, but it still vibrates :-( ).
